niucloud-admin/niucloud/public/admin/assets/cash_out-64cfb528.js
2023-05-31 11:51:07 +08:00

2 lines
4.6 KiB
JavaScript

import"./base-962c0c23.js";/* empty css *//* empty css *//* empty css *//* empty css *//* empty css */import{E as A,b as D}from"./el-radio-bfd4b1ad.js";/* empty css */import{s as O}from"./index-f1b9f75f.js";import{t as l}from"./index-e8f72538.js";import{b as S,H as G,I as H}from"./member-dd698f0f.js";import{a as I,E as L}from"./index-61c777fa.js";import{E as W}from"./index-93f2c618.js";import{E as M,a as P}from"./index-df51d91a.js";import{E as j}from"./index-69523418.js";import{E as q}from"./index-bba9e58c.js";import{v as $}from"./directive-c0c3e9a3.js";import{d as J,r as v,M as E,b as i,e as k,L as K,m,p as o,q as s,u as n,C as c,v as d,x as _,F as Q,t as X,f as y}from"./runtime-core.esm-bundler-dc7a07d7.js";import"./event-ff03ec12.js";import"./vue-router-79053937.js";import"./el-overlay-60700377.js";import"./index-5d86eb33.js";import"./focus-trap-b8b5a003.js";import"./storage-abe718b1.js";import"./index-8bcaafa6.js";import"./index-7a123a20.js";import"./_plugin-vue_export-helper-c27b6911.js";import"./el-tooltip-58212670.js";import"./el-avatar-3bb47ce2.js";import"./index-d57cc47d.js";import"./common-6291c908.js";import"./common-2cf17469.js";import"./_Uint8Array-6ff3cafa.js";import"./_initCloneObject-28e6bdaa.js";import"./isEqual-c7d5e6d9.js";import"./flatten-d5d1dc97.js";const Y={class:"main-container"},Z=y("span",{class:"ml-2"},"%",-1),ee={class:"fixed-footer-wrap"},te={class:"fixed-footer"},Me=J({__name:"cash_out",setup(oe){const f=v(!0),g=v(),t=E({is_auto_transfer:"0",is_auto_verify:"0",is_open:"0",min:"0.01",rate:"0",transfer_type:[]}),V=v([]);(async()=>{V.value=await(await S()).data})(),(async(u=0)=>{const e=await(await G()).data;Object.keys(t).forEach(a=>{e[a]!=null&&(t[a]=e[a])}),t.is_open=Boolean(Number(t.is_open)),f.value=!1})();const x=E({min:[{validator:(u,e,a)=>{Number(e)<.01?a(new Error(l("cashWithdrawalAmountHint"))):a()},trigger:"blur"}],rate:[{validator:(u,e,a)=>{Number(e)>100||Number(e)<0?a(new Error(l("commissionRatioHint"))):a()},trigger:"blur"}]}),C=async u=>{f.value||!u||await u.validate(e=>{if(e){let a={...t};a.is_open=Number(a.is_open).toString(),H(a).then(()=>{f.value=!1}).catch(()=>{f.value=!1})}})};return(u,e)=>{const a=O,p=I,h=W,b=A,w=D,R=M,F=P,N=j,T=L,B=q,U=$;return i(),k("div",Y,[K((i(),m(T,{model:t,"label-width":"150px",ref_key:"ruleFormRef",ref:g,rules:x,class:"page-form"},{default:o(()=>[s(N,{class:"box-card !border-none",shadow:"never"},{default:o(()=>[s(p,{label:n(l)("isOpen")},{default:o(()=>[s(a,{modelValue:t.is_open,"onUpdate:modelValue":e[0]||(e[0]=r=>t.is_open=r)},null,8,["modelValue"])]),_:1},8,["label"]),t.is_open?(i(),m(p,{key:0,label:n(l)("cashWithdrawalAmount"),prop:"min"},{default:o(()=>[s(h,{modelValue:t.min,"onUpdate:modelValue":e[1]||(e[1]=r=>t.min=r),class:"w-60",type:"number",placeholder:n(l)("cashWithdrawalAmountPlaceholder")},null,8,["modelValue","placeholder"])]),_:1},8,["label"])):c("",!0),t.is_open?(i(),m(p,{key:1,label:n(l)("commissionRatio"),prop:"rate"},{default:o(()=>[s(h,{modelValue:t.rate,"onUpdate:modelValue":e[2]||(e[2]=r=>t.rate=r),type:"number",class:"w-60",placeholder:n(l)("commissionRatioPlaceholder")},null,8,["modelValue","placeholder"]),Z]),_:1},8,["label"])):c("",!0),t.is_open?(i(),m(p,{key:2,label:n(l)("audit"),class:"items-center"},{default:o(()=>[s(w,{modelValue:t.is_auto_verify,"onUpdate:modelValue":e[3]||(e[3]=r=>t.is_auto_verify=r)},{default:o(()=>[s(b,{label:"0",size:"large"},{default:o(()=>[d(_(n(l)("manualAudit")),1)]),_:1}),s(b,{label:"1",size:"large"},{default:o(()=>[d(_(n(l)("automaticAudit")),1)]),_:1})]),_:1},8,["modelValue"])]),_:1},8,["label"])):c("",!0),t.is_open?(i(),m(p,{key:3,label:n(l)("transfer"),class:"items-center"},{default:o(()=>[s(w,{modelValue:t.is_auto_transfer,"onUpdate:modelValue":e[4]||(e[4]=r=>t.is_auto_transfer=r)},{default:o(()=>[s(b,{label:"0",size:"large"},{default:o(()=>[d(_(n(l)("manualTransfer")),1)]),_:1}),s(b,{label:"1",size:"large"},{default:o(()=>[d(_(n(l)("automatedTransit")),1)]),_:1})]),_:1},8,["modelValue"])]),_:1},8,["label"])):c("",!0),t.is_open?(i(),m(p,{key:4,label:n(l)("transferMode"),class:"items-center"},{default:o(()=>[s(F,{modelValue:t.transfer_type,"onUpdate:modelValue":e[5]||(e[5]=r=>t.transfer_type=r),size:"large"},{default:o(()=>[(i(!0),k(Q,null,X(V.value,(r,z)=>(i(),m(R,{label:r.key,key:"a"+z},{default:o(()=>[d(_(r.name),1)]),_:2},1032,["label"]))),128))]),_:1},8,["modelValue"])]),_:1},8,["label"])):c("",!0)]),_:1})]),_:1},8,["model","rules"])),[[U,f.value]]),y("div",ee,[y("div",te,[s(B,{type:"primary",onClick:e[6]||(e[6]=r=>C(g.value))},{default:o(()=>[d(_(n(l)("save")),1)]),_:1})])])])}}});export{Me as default};